What's The Definition Of Sodium hydrogencarbonate?

[n] a white soluble compound used in effervescent drinks and in baking powders and as an antacid

Synonyms | Synonyms for Sodium hydrogencarbonate: baking soda | bicarbonate of soda | saleratus | sodium bicarbonate
